Four Japanese antennas for ALMA

Three 12-metre and one 7-metre MELCO antennas at the Japanese assembly facility, near the main ALMA Operations Support Facility (OSF), located at 2900m altitude on the road to the Chajnantor plateau. ALMA is a single telescope of revolutionary design, composed of a main array of fifty 12-metre antennas and an additional compact array of four 12-metre and twelve 7-metre antennas. ALMA is currently under construction on the Chajnantor plateau, at an elevation of 5000m, in the Chilean Andes.
